Seat Belt Systems: Description and Operation











The front seats are equipped with automatic shoulder seat belts. The shoulder seat belt retractor installed on each front seat, is designed to lock in the event of a sudden stop or deceleration. When a door is opened or the shoulder buckle motor is operating, a solenoid in each shoulder seat belt retractor is energized, disabling the shoulder seat belt retractors and permitting free movement of the shoulder seat belt. In the same way, when the ignition switch is OFF, the shoulder seat belt retractor is unlocked for 3 minutes after the door is closed.
